Ali Fazal's Mother Passes Away In Lucknow, 'Mirzapur' Actor Pens Emotional Post For Her

“I’ll live the rest of yours for you,": Ali Fazal shared a heartfelt post for his mother on social media.

New Delhi: Bollywood actor Alia Fazal’s mother left for her heavenly abode on Wednesday morning (June 17) in Lucknow. She passed away due to health complications. Ali’s spokesperson released an official statement, which read: “It is with great sorrow we inform you that Ali Fazal’s mother passed away on the morning of June 17, 2020 in Lucknow after quick succession of health complications. Her passing was sudden and we pray for her peace. Ali is grateful for the love and support of his fans in these testing times. A personal loss of this magnitude also needs silence. He tweeted, “I’ll live the rest of yours for you. Miss you Amma. Yahi tak thhaa humaara, pata nahi kyun. You were the source of my creativity. My everything. Aagey alfaaz nahi rahe. Love, Ali.”
Several Bollywood celebs including Ali’s girlfriend Richa Chadha, Pulkit Samrat commented on his post. Richa, while replying to Ali's picture, wrote,"hang in there... Rest in peace Auntie."
Pulkit, who worked with Ali in 'Fukrey' and 'Fukrey Returns', wrote, "Prayers bhai!! So sorry for your loss!! RIP Auntie."
'Four More Shots Please' actress Sayani Gupta tweeted, "Oh god Ali! So sorry. Big big hug brother!"
Ali Fazal was all set to tie the knot with Richa in April 2020 in Mumbai. The couple had to postpone their wedding due to the COVID-19 outbreak in the country. They issued a statement which read, "Given the current scenario and the unfortunate turn of events owing to the COVID-19 pandemic globally, Ali Fazal and Richa Chadha have decided to postpone their wedding functions to the later half of 2020 tentatively. They wish for everyone to be healthy and safe and at no cost would want their friends, families and well wishers to be affected."
On the professional front, Ali Fazal has ' Death on the Nile' and 'Mirzapur' in his kitty. He has featured in films like 'Prassthanam', 'Khamoshiyan', 'Happy Bhaag Jayegi' and 'Always Kabhi Kabhi', to name a few.
